bolk
0
pg_basebackup не пробовали?
bolk
–1
Команды «cp» не будет? Очень сильно сомневаюсь. Не нужно в крайности впадать.
bolk
0
Наиболее очевиден, по-моему, cp /dev/null myfile. Этот вариант ещё и с sudo нормально работает в отличие от.
bolk
0
Я на это всё наткнулся за десятилетие до «семёрки». Ну и попробуйте объяснить себе второй пример в «семёрке». :)
bolk
0
Нелогично ему :) Потому что у вас передача по значению. Представьте себе, что это просто цикл, который выполняет последовательные действия и всё встанет на свои места.

Не запуская, попробуйте угадать результат (на PHP5):
$a = []; list($a[], $a[]) = [1,2]; var_dump($a);

$a = [1]; list($a[], $a[]) = $a; var_dump($a);
bolk
+2
PHP — первый язык с современной криптографий в стандартной поставке — О принятом недавно предложении включить библиотеку Libsodium в ядро начиная с PHP 7.2.

Опять всё в процедурном стиле :(

bolk
0

Я как-то писал вроде самый пока сильно оптимизирующий интерпретатор/компилятор —https://github.com/bolknote/brainfuck. По ссылке его порт с JS. Основной приход с развёртки циклов в конструкции без циклов. Правда я его подзабросил, надоело, в нём так и остались неисправленные баги.

bolk
0

Ого, было бы интересно прочитать про ваш жизненный путь, чем занимаетесь сейчас, чем планируете заниматься.

bolk
+12

А у вас что, квантовый компьютер есть?

bolk
–3

Уважаемая компания Интел!


Я понимаю, ваша исконная культура — американская и базируется на английском языке. Я не уверен насчёт того как в английском, но в русском не принято густо использовать одно название по всему тексту. Его принято, один раз упомянув полностью, в дальнейшем упоминать частями или заменять местоимениями.


У вас почти два десятка «Xeon Phi» по всему небольшому тексту. В глазах рябит и воспринимается как агрессивная реклама.

bolk
0

Окно браузера задаёт размер всех закладок разом.

bolk
0

Вы не поняли что я хочу сказать. Верстать на 960 пикселей — нормально, если веб-приложение (сайт) так хочет. Ненормально, что веб-приложение при этом можно распахнуть на весь экран.

bolk
0

Нет ничего страшного в том, что сайт не занимает всё ширину. Просто бразеры сейчас не адаптированы под всё увеличивающуюся ширину экрана. Это особенно заметно на Эпл Синема. Часть приложений ограничено в размерах и не даёт распахнуть себя на весь экран, браузеру это бы тоже поучиться делать. До прихода табов это можно было делать вручную, теперь, увы, не получается. Застой не в интерфейсах сообщений на сайтах, там напротив, обкатаны все модели расположения, остаётся фильтровать по-умному разве что. Застой в браузерах — они до сих пор работают так как будто у всех мониторы в 13 дюймов.

bolk
0

Там скорее всего память на магнитных сердечниках. В 1977 «винты» вряд ли могли считаться достаточно надёжными для космоса.

bolk
0

Смотря какой ресурс у менее дорогих. Что с поддержкой, сколько IOPS и так далее. Может и буду.

bolk
+2

Потому что на космических аппаратах, которые летят в открытый космос с 1977 года очень непросто поменять жёсткие диски.

bolk
0

DISCo Commander ещё был, но им почти никто не пользовался.

bolk
+1

Я несколько лет лаборантил в КГУ (сейчас КФУ), среди моих классов был один на PC XT, вот там на все компы я ставил PTS-DOS и VC, а так же свои собственные припарки (вроде увеличения таймингов памяти). Каждый компонент был подобран эксперементально, тормозило куда меньше.

bolk
+1

Он, кстати, был в разы быстрее «Нортона» на слабых машинах и занимал меньше.

bolk
+2

Вопросы к согласованности статьи — к автору статьи.

bolk
+2

Вы почему-то не обратили на это внимание, но я упрощаю команды, взятые из статьи, а не свои придумываю. И после упрощения команд в строке становится меньше, а не больше.

bolk
+4

У вас там ограничение по длине строки, а вы символы щедрою рукою на антипаттерн «бесполезная кошка» расходуете:


$(cat /tmp/a|head -1>/tmp/b) #filter for the first row
$(cat</tmp/b|tr -d ' '>/tmp/c) #filter out unwanted characters

Так правильно:


$(head -1 /tmp/a>/tmp/b) #filter for the first row
$(tr -d ' '</tmp/b>/tmp/c) #filter out unwanted characters
bolk
+5
биллионах

«Биллиона» в русском нет, это миллиард.

bolk
+3

Поддерживаю на 100%. У меня много запросов по которым «Яндекс» выдаёт чепуху, приходится тратить время и лазить по ссылкам только для того, чтобы убедиться, что заданных слов на страниц нет. «Гугл», если выкидывает слова, прямо об этом сообщает — по снипетами выкинутые слова будут зачёркнуты.

bolk
0
Используйте «with», с ним код становится чище и его можно читать сверху вниз, а не петлять среди блоков join'ов.

Только оптимизатор Постгреса (в отличие от Оракла) не умеет заглядывать за «with», это для него как отдельный запрос, так что такое разбиение может (и скорее всего будет) работать существенно медленнее исходного запроса.


Если можете написать запрос без временных таблиц — не раздумывайте и напишите! Обычно CTE, создаваемое конструкцией «with», является приемлемой альтернативой. Дело в том, что PostgreSQL для каждой временной таблицы создает временный файл…

А какая база делает иначе? Как СУБД может предугадать сколько данных в таблице будет? Вроде логично всё. Не перепутаны ли тут временные таблицы с временными вьхами?

bolk
0

В теории это позволяет добиться невиданной переносимости — ваш HTML+JS одинаково запустится на айОС, Андроиде, ВинФоне и ещё-что-там-появится-через-год. На практике это верно пока только для очень простых приложений, но там нет ничего нерешаемого.

bolk
0

Как парочку (или больше уже?) лет назад услышал о третьей версии «Сфинкса», так до сих пор на каждой конференции слышу как «мы его только начали его разрабатывать». Как так-то?

bolk
+5

В Unicode многие символы моложе 18 лет!

bolk
+1

Разве с выходом нового ФЗ ЭПЦ сейчас не называется ЭП?

bolk
0

Всё-таки если у нас есть любое количество, то не соглашусь, да, это будет дорого, долго, стоимость изменений будет очень высокой, но это возможно.

bolk
+1

Через месяц выйдет ещё одна статья на «Хабре» как этот пост «догрел» аудиторию :)

bolk
0

Понятно. Я думал речь о пароле к самой синхронизации.

bolk
–2

В нашей системе (это документооборот) у аккаунта несколько клиентских устройств. У каждого свой пароль (=токен), у каждого своя карточка доступа, любое устройство можно отключить, не отключая остальные. Каждый токен хранится в захешированном виде. Не вижу проблем.

bolk
0

«Пластиковые окна дёшево» теперь и в «Инсте». Я, когда вижу такую рекламу (особенно когда меня лайкает подобный аккаунт), просто пополняю свой чёрный список.